Understanding the Landscape: Is It Legal?
The legality of employing a hacker depends totally on the intent and the consent approved. Hiring someone to gain unauthorized access to an account or computer that does not belong to the company is a crime in practically every jurisdiction. Conversely, working with an expert to evaluate one's own systems, recover a forgotten password, or examine a cybersecurity breach on one's own infrastructure is a legitimate practice known as ethical hacking.

1. Penetration Testing (Vulnerability Assessment)
Businesses Hire White Hat Hacker ethical hackers to imitate an attack on their own networks. By identifying weak points before a malicious star does, the company can patch vulnerabilities and protect client data.
2. Digital Forensics and Investigation
After a security breach or a case of digital fraud, a forensic hacker can trace the origin of the attack. They recover logs, determine the trespasser's methodology, and supply documentation that can be utilized in legal procedures.
3. Account and Data Recovery
In instances where an individual is locked out of their own encrypted hard disk or social networks account, and basic recovery approaches stop working, a hacker can use specific tools to bypass regional locks or recuperate damaged sectors of a disk.

Q2: Can a hacker recuperate deleted files from a formatted computer?
In a lot of cases, yes. Professional hackers and forensic specialists use tools that can recuperate information from sectors of a hard disk drive that have not yet been overwritten by brand-new data.
